from the point p(-2,4) if PQ is drawn perpendicular to line 7x-24y+10=0,find the eqaution of the lin PQ . also determine the length of PQ

Answers

Answer:

7y+24x = -12

Step-by-step explanation:

Equation of line PQ in point slope form is expressed as;

y -y0 = m(x-x0)

m is the slope of {Q

(x0, y0) is the point on the line

Given the line 7x-24y+10=0

Get the slope

-24y = -7x -10

y = -7/-24 x - 10/-24

y = 7/24 x + 5/12

Slope = 7/24

Slope of the line PQ perpendicular to it = -24/7

Substitute m = -24/7 and (-2, 4) into the formula;

y - 4 = -24/7(x+2)

7(y-4) = -24(x+2)

7y - 28 = -24x-48

7y + 24x = -40 + 28

7y+24x = -12

This gives the equation of the line PQ

7 t - shirts and a hat cost 67.00
5 t - shirts and a hat costs 49.00
How much does a hat cost?
How much does a t - shirt cost?

Answers

Answer:

Hat costs 4.00

T-Shirt costs 9.00

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the t-shirt be t and the hat be h

7t+h=67

5t+h=49

Equating by eliminating the h and subtracting

the two equations,

2t=18

t=9.

If t =9 in 5t + h= 49 then

5×9+h=49

45+h=49

h=4

Expand and simplify (x − 3)(2x + 3)(4x + 5)

Answers

Answer:

8x³ - 2x² - 51x - 45

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

(x - 3)(2x + 3)(4x + 5) ← expand second/third factors using FOIL

= (x - 3)(8x² + 22x + 15) ← distribute

= x(8x² + 22x + 15) - 3(8x² + 22x + 15) ← distribute parenthesis

= 8x³ + 22x² + 15x - 24x² - 66x - 45 ← collect like terms

= 8x³ - 2x² - 51x - 45
